Review of A Good Day to Die Hard (2013) by Thequietgamer — 31 Oct 2013
A fairly mediocre action movie. Some action scenes are nice, but we've all seen better by now. The plot ends up going nowhere and is muddled by constantly shoehorning in lame father-son moments. These two don't have the best relationship, we get it.
Needless to say because of this there are a lot of cliches in this movie. I'm also disappointed with Jai Courtney in this. After watching him nail it as Varro in Spartacus: Blood and Sand it's painful to see him barely trying here.
Bruce Willis does ok but is still nothing to write home about. It's not terribly bad, but there are a lot of better action movies out there.
